In the single machine environment, several schedul-ing algorithms exist that allow to quantify schedules with respect to feasibility, optimality, etc. In contrast, reconfigurable devices execute tasks in parallel, which intentionally collides with the single machine princi-ple and seems to require new methods and evaluation strategies for scheduling. However, the reconfiguration phases of adaptable architectures usually take place se-quentially. Run-time adaptation is realized using an exclusive port, which is occupied for some reasonable time during reconfiguration. Thus, we can find an anal-ogy to the single machine environment. In this paper, we investigate the appliance of single processor schedul-ing algorithms to task reconfiguration ...
Summarization: Partial reconfiguration suffers from the inherent high latency and low throughput whi...
Reconfigurable computing has become an important part of research in software systems and computer a...
Reservation-based scheduling mechanisms have suc-cessfully been used for supporting real-time applic...
Considering nowadays FPGAs, the reconfiguration time is a non-negligible element of reconfigurable c...
Embedded Reconfigurable Architectures (ERA) is a project with the objective to design a platform tha...
International audienceThis paper deals with the real-time scheduling in a reconfigurable multi-core ...
We consider the problem of executing a dynamically changing set of tasks on a reconfigurable system,...
Several embedded application domains for reconfigurable systems tend to combine frequent changes wit...
At present, the critical computations of real-time systems are guaranteed before runtime by performi...
New generation embedded systems demand high performance, efficiency and flexibility. Reconfigurable ...
Summarization: Partial reconfiguration (PR) of FPGAs can be used to dynamically extend and adapt the...
In this dissertation, we propose the design of a simulation framework to investigate the performance...
Reconfigurable computing is emerging as a viable design alternative to implement a wide range of com...
Aim of this paper is to define a scheduling of the task graph of an application that minimizes its t...
High-performance reconfigurable computing involves acceleration of significant portions of an ap-pli...
Summarization: Partial reconfiguration suffers from the inherent high latency and low throughput whi...
Reconfigurable computing has become an important part of research in software systems and computer a...
Reservation-based scheduling mechanisms have suc-cessfully been used for supporting real-time applic...
Considering nowadays FPGAs, the reconfiguration time is a non-negligible element of reconfigurable c...
Embedded Reconfigurable Architectures (ERA) is a project with the objective to design a platform tha...
International audienceThis paper deals with the real-time scheduling in a reconfigurable multi-core ...
We consider the problem of executing a dynamically changing set of tasks on a reconfigurable system,...
Several embedded application domains for reconfigurable systems tend to combine frequent changes wit...
At present, the critical computations of real-time systems are guaranteed before runtime by performi...
New generation embedded systems demand high performance, efficiency and flexibility. Reconfigurable ...
Summarization: Partial reconfiguration (PR) of FPGAs can be used to dynamically extend and adapt the...
In this dissertation, we propose the design of a simulation framework to investigate the performance...
Reconfigurable computing is emerging as a viable design alternative to implement a wide range of com...
Aim of this paper is to define a scheduling of the task graph of an application that minimizes its t...
High-performance reconfigurable computing involves acceleration of significant portions of an ap-pli...
Summarization: Partial reconfiguration suffers from the inherent high latency and low throughput whi...
Reconfigurable computing has become an important part of research in software systems and computer a...
Reservation-based scheduling mechanisms have suc-cessfully been used for supporting real-time applic...